WebJul 8, 2024 · Biochemical analyses indicated that male sea lamprey increase pheromone production, transport and release when exposed to a major pheromone component, 3kPZS. Across all experiments, 94% of males increased 3kPZS release, and the increases in two separate experiments averaged 92% and 205%, resulting in concentration changes that … WebNov 11, 2024 · Strategies to increase pheromone production using synthetic biology approaches require designing optimal pheromone biosynthetic pathway, and protein engineering of key enzymes with high activities.
